Smile Alternator help please

Hi,

I'm after an alternator for my 2004 WRX. Could anyone please confirm the correct pulley dimension I need please? as im finding a 55mm and a 54mm both keep coming up in search results.

there is a part number on the std one that you need to match as they are a "smart" style and will throw a CEL if the incorrect part is fitted (even if charging)

As fitted to ModelYear 03/04/05 UK 2.0L Impreza WRX



Aftermarket units seem to quote 54 or 55 mm pulley diameter and either 80 or 90A output.

Workshop Manual quotes 90A for UK models
